ManpowerGroup Inc. (NYSE:MAN – Get Free Report) has been given a consensus recommendation of “Hold” by the five research firms that are presently covering the stock, Marketbeat Ratings reports. Five anal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ation. The average twelve-month price objective among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$50.60.
Several brokerages have recently commented on MAN. Truist Financial decreased their price target on ManpowerGroup from $55.00 to $48.00 and set a “hold” rating on the stock in a research note on Monday, April 21st. UBS Group decreased their target price on ManpowerGroup from $63.00 to $57.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, April 10th. BMO Capital Markets lowered their target price on ManpowerGroup from $54.00 to $48.00 and set a “market perform” rating on the stock in a report on Monday, April 21st. Barclays upgraded ManpowerGroup from an “underweight” rating to an “equal weight” rating and dropped their price target for the company from $55.00 to $50.00 in a research report on Thursday, April 10th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. lowered their price objective on shares of ManpowerGroup from $65.00 to $50.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a research note on Monday, April 21st.

ManpowerGroup Price Performance
ManpowerGroup (NYSE:MAN –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 17th. The business services provider reported $0.44 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.52 by ($0.08). ManpowerGroup had a return on equity of 9.10% and a net margin of 0.63%. The company had revenue of $698.30 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.94 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$0.94 EPS. Analysts forecast that ManpowerGroup will post 4.23 EPS for the current fiscal year.
ManpowerGroup Cuts Dividend
The business also recently announced a semi-annual d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 16th. Shareholders of record on Monday, June 2nd were issued a dividend of $0.72 per share. This represents a yield of 3.5%. The ex-dividend date was Monday, June 2nd. ManpowerGroup’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 62.61%.

ManpowerGroup Company Profile
ManpowerGroup Inc provides workforce solutions and services worldwide. The company offers recruitment services, including permanent, temporary, and contract recruitment of professionals, as well as administrative and industrial positions under the Manpower and Experis brands. It also offers various assessment services; training and development services; career and talent management; and outsourcing services related to human resources functions primarily in the areas of large-scale recruiting and workforce-intensive initiatives.
